Explanation:
Detailed explanation-1: -The American Heart Association advises limiting sugar to about 8 percent of your diet, or six teaspoons a day for women and nine for men.
Detailed explanation-2: -2. New FDA guidelines suggest 10 percent of daily calories from added sugars. For 2000 calories per day, 50 grams of added sugars, about 12 teaspoons.
Detailed explanation-3: -What 5 percent means. For an adult within the normal body-mass-index range, 5 percent of total daily calories would be about 25 grams-or six teaspoons-of sugar.
